Key Battery Replacement

BMW owners often find themselves with a dead or malfunctioning key fob. It may seem overwhelming to attempt to replace the battery yourself, but the process is actually simple. You can get your BMW key fob back to working order for just a couple of dollars.

The first step is to buy a new CR2032 battery for your key fob. These are easily available at convenience stores and parts centers for less than 10 dollars. You'll also require a small object like a screwdriver or a pair pliers. Once you have these, carefully cut open the fob with the gap created by the object. Once you can see the old battery, take it off it and insert the new one in the holder or clip. Once the battery is placed, connect the key fob and then close it.

Based on the model and year, depending on the year and model, your BMW may use a different type of battery. Some BMWs within the F-Series range between 2011 and 2017 come with an elegant, slant-shaped power supply. To change the battery on this kind of key, you'll need remove the valet from the metal and push a small tab on the side. When you are able to see the access port for the battery, you can take it out it using a small device such as an screwdriver to move the small groove in the opening.

Once the old battery is removed, place the new battery in its holder or clip and ensure that it's secured. Slide the blade of the key back into the fob. The head of a screwdriver in tape to avoid scratching.

You will need to provide your registration and identification documents in order to order a new BMW Key. Keys are a security-sensitive component of your vehicle, so BMW requires that only the registered owner order a new key from their dealership. If the name that appears on the registration is different from the driver's name the registered owner will also require proof of marriage or name change (such as a marriage certificate) to the dealership.
